Output 6873e5ef8238d7354a36305f514d035cd73fd6b919cfd00788410ecada4c0bd4:18

value
158205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ccca5aa04520d236c93d0733a3b0a4296c28cce OP_EQUAL
address
3PH6YwtwTsUhi7bX1ykLhvuymaWqL8omAk
transaction
6873e5ef8238d7354a36305f514d035cd73fd6b919cfd00788410ecada4c0bd4
spent
true